Description

Durable gas-pressure rear shock absorber for Ford Bantam and Mazda Rustler bakkies. Designed to fit a wide range of petrol and diesel variants, this twin-tube telescopic damper provides reliable load handling, improved stability, and a smoother ride on South African roads and work routes.

Vehicle Compatibility

  • Ford Bantam 1300 (B3) – 1994–2002
  • Ford Bantam 1.3i (ROCAM A9JA) – 2002–2011
  • Ford Bantam 1.4 TDCi (Duratorq) – 2009–2011
  • Ford Bantam 1600 (F6) – 1994–2002
  • Ford Bantam 1600i (B6) – 1994–2002
  • Ford Bantam 1.6i (ROCAM) – 2002–2011
  • Ford Bantam 1.8D (RTP) – 2002–2006
  • Mazda Rustler 130 (B3) – 1994–2002
  • Mazda Rustler 160 (F6 8V) – 1994–2002
  • Mazda Rustler 160i (B6) – 1994–2002

Specifications

  • Fitting Position: Rear Axle
  • Shock Absorber Type: Gas Pressure
  • Shock Absorber Design: Telescopic Shock Absorber
  • Shock Absorber System: Twin-Tube
  • Shock Absorber Mounting Type: Top eye
  • Shock Absorber Mounting Type: Bottom eye
